HB 5071 Rhode Island House · 2025 Regular Session

AN ACT RELATING TO CRIMINAL OFFENSES -- THREATS AND EXTORTION

HB 5071 amends Rhode Island law to expand the definition of "public official" under threats and extortion statutes. It specifically adds state government caseworkers (social workers who help individuals access government resources) and investigators to the list of protected individuals. This means threatening these workers because of their job duties would now be a felony, punishable by up to five years in prison, a $5,000 fine, or both. The bill does not create new penalties but extends existing legal protections to these specific state employees. The change takes effect upon passage.
